Cassis Farmers’ Market takes place at place de la République, in Cassis. The public schedule is 1 January 2026 to 31 December 2026, every Saturday from 8:30 AM to 12:30 PM. Its regional value is practical and everyday: producers, artisans and regular marketgoers keep the open-air market as part of local life. The Cassis Farmers’ Market is an established weekly destination featuring local farmers showcasing their fresh, seasonal products. Open every Saturday from 8:30 AM to 12:30 PM, the market is well-regarded for its diverse offerings, which include vegetables, fruits, honeys, olive oil, olives, breads, and pastries. As part of the ADEAR 13 markets, all products are traceable and adhere to strict quality standards.
